Sonex Research, Inc. developed its patented and patent pending Sonex Combustion System (SCS) technology which enables major advancements in the state-of-the-art of combustion in two-stroke and four-stroke internal combustion engines. Sonex was founded by Dr. Andrew A. Pouring, a former Professor of Aerospace Engineering and Chairman of the Department of Aerospace Engineering at the U.S. Naval Academy.

Sonex has licensed several applications of its technology. SCS applications include:

• Convert gasoline engines to run on safer diesel-kerosene-type “heavy fuels” for use in military and commercial applications such as Unmanned Aerial Vehicles (UAVs) and generator sets
• Improve combustion stability, fuel consumption, power, emissions and reliability of stationary engines operating on natural gas
• Lean-burn combustion process for the automotive market for gasoline direct injected (GDI) engines to cost effectively improve fuel mileage by 25% and reduce CO2, NOX and UHC emissions to lowest level possible.
• Reduction of particulates in direct injected diesel engines

Sonex has not been an operating company since 2020 when it closed its facility. The Company conducts business in connection with the litigation settlement and is accepting technology licensing or purchase offers.
